Best Gears?

I might be buying an AOD Tranny to replace my 3 on the tree. I was wondering what gears I should put in it? If I am not able to ge the AOD I am going to get a C4 if I get the C4 what gears should I get in it? Also where would be a good place to start looking for a C4 besides the Buy and Sell.

I want an automatic tranny with good gears for a 302, I want good acceleration, I am not going to be towing anything. I just want somthing that is fun to play arround with. Thanks in advance.

What gears you should use depends on your engine power and outside tire diameter. The more power, torq, you have the taller the tire you can run with any given gear. It also depends on your driving style. I know a guy who runs 3.73 with 40" denman groundhawgs, and doesn't seem to have problems. With a 302 and a auto trany gears between 3.5:1 and 4.11:1 should do fine with tires between 28-33". Again it all depends on you type of driving and engine power range.

ok. my 78 has a 302, aod, and 9" rearend, with 3:50 gears.and 235/75 15"S...... for mild towing, and flat areas, this is great,.... decient go... great milage..... but where i live there's lots of hills.... and since i bought my grandmarquis. then f-100 isn't on the highway nearly as much..... i personally think the 4:10's would suit me much better, and at 65 mph, i'd be turning 2400 rpms. which is just in the range for the 302. i'm turnin 2000 rpm now, with the 3:50's.. for all around, i'd go with 3:73's if you can find them, and 4:10's if you plan to work it.

btw, i've just completed my 3rd install of a 302, and aod in these truck... 77 f-100, 78 f-100, and a 66 f-250 with 4:10's. but it's not road leagal yet to see how it works.

joetee10, i have the AOD(automatic overdrive) tranny, 2000 rpm is in the .67 to 1 od gear
it turns closer to 2400 in drive, 3rd gear, 1:1, same as your c-4, this is actually at 105 km/h... just took a rough guess at the mph also, your tires are a lower profile.... it's not much, but it would make them a little smaller od, and chang your rpm's a little.


dave, i'd say that you'd be happy with the AOD, and 4:10 gears. still very drivable on the highway, fairly decient mileage, and lots of bottom end.... good for play... i drove mine for 2 years with the aod, and 2:73's....... that was a little painfull, but great on gas... lol i've got 400,000 km's on my tranny and it's still goin strong.
